The Ordem dos Engenheiros is the Public Professional Association representing professionals practising engineering in Portugal.
Founded in 1869, with the creation of the Associação dos Engenheiros Civis Portugueses, the Ordem dos Engenheiros was formally established under its current legal designation in 1936. It is independent from state bodies and enjoys administrative, financial, scientific and disciplinary autonomy, being governed by its Statute, last revised in 2024.
The Association regulates access to and practice of the engineering profession, awards the professional title of Engineer and acts as the competent authority for the application of European Union legislation on the recognition of professional qualifications.
In addition to regulating access to and practice of the engineering profession, the Association's mission is to contribute to the defence, promotion and advancement of engineering, to encourage its members' efforts in the scientific, professional and social fields, and to defend the ethics, professional conduct, recognition and qualifications of engineers.
Internally, the Ordem dos Engenheiros is organised into 17 Colleges of Specialisation, reflecting the diversity of engineering disciplines in Portugal.
The Portuguese FEANI Committee was created in 1993.
